We've secured a distribution hub outside Strenholt and hired a regional lead with strong trade contacts. Initial focus is the Calloway product range, with pricing pitched 8% under the incumbent, Durnmere Supplies. Break-even is modelled at month fourteen. Risks: local regulatory approvals are slower than planned, and Durnmere may respond with discounting. Marketing spend is front-loaded into the first six weeks. The following strategic context should not be shared outside this office.

management briefing: The pricing group signed off on a budget of $378.8 million for Project Kasael.

TICKET VX-2291: `tailgrip` CLI fails signature verification on v3.4.1 binaries pulled from the internal mirror. Checksums match upstream; signature does not. Suspect the release pipeline signed with the retired Quillbrook key after last week's rotation. Log tailing is blocked for the ops group until resolved. Re-signed artifacts are staged. For verification, the key currently trusted by the mirror is reproduced here.

signing key of bagap-yawep = bky13_TbfT6ZMUoGJo2

**Schema registry bits (for plugin folks)**

Heads up: all events flowing through Quillbus must have their schemas registered with Ledgerbird before the broker will accept them. Register once per version; backward-compatible changes only, or the check will bounce you. Compatibility mode is enforced server-side, so no sneaky field removals. The registry connection settings your plugin needs are as follows.

service settings:
[silwyn]
host = silwyn.crelvogrid.internal
user = silwyn_svc
database = silwyn_prod